Our meeting point will be the church of San Gregorio Armeno. From the first access, the splendor will completely overwhelm you: from the ceiling, passing through the pulpits and chapels. Our journey will continue to Piazzetta Nilo, with the large sculpture of the Nile God, and the next stop is the church of Gesù Vecchio. The Jesuit order used the spectacularness of the Baroque to directly strike the faithful, who also became a spectator. This is precisely the first mother church of the order. Over time, and with the exponential increase in the power and importance of the Order of the Jesuits in Naples, a new building was chosen as a reference point: we are heading towards the church of Gesù Nuovo, located in the square of the same name. It was a civil building, Palazzo Sanseverino, then disused and used as a sacred building. The entrance is truly spectacular! The last stop is the the cloister of Santa Chira: in an almost mystical peace, the most precious maiolicas of the city.
